, finance - ANSWER the system that includes the circulation of money, the granting of
credit, the making of investments, and the provision of banking facilities
financial management (corporate finance) - ANSWER focuses on decisions relating to
how much and what types of assets to acquire, how to raise the capital needed to
purchase assets, and how to run the firm so as to maximize its value
capital markets - ANSWER relate to the markets where interest rates, along with stock
and bond prices, are determined
investments - ANSWER relate to decisions concerning with stocks and bonds and
include a number of activites
security analysis - ANSWER deals with finding the proper values of individual securities
(i.e. stocks and bonds)
portfolio theory - ANSWER deals with the best way to structure portfolios, or 'baskets' of
stocks and bonds
market analysis - ANSWER deals with the issue of whether stock and bond markets at
any given time are 'too high', 'too low', or 'about right.'
behavioral finance - ANSWER investor psychology is examined in an effort to determine
whether stock prices have been bid up to unreasonable heights in a speculative bubble
or driven down to unreasonable lows in a fit of irrational pessimism
finance within the organization - ANSWER board of directors--> CEO --> COO (chief
operating officer) + CFO (chief financial officer)
COO--> Marketing, Production, HR, Other Operating Departments
CFO--> Accounting, Treasury, Credit, Legal, Capital Budgeting, and Investor Realtions
Sarbanes-Oxley Act - ANSWER A law passed by Congress that requires the CEO and
CFO to certify that their firm's financial statements are accurate
